Advanced Surgical Techniques



When it comes to cataract surgery, progressed medical strategies have revolutionized the means this typical treatment is done. With the introduction of phacoemulsification, a minimally invasive procedure, doctors can now make smaller sized lacerations, bring about quicker healing times and lowered threat of problems. This strategy utilizes ultrasound to break up the cloudy lens, which is after that gotten rid of with a tiny probe.

Furthermore, making use of femtosecond laser modern technology has improved the accuracy of cataract surgery by helping in developing exact incisions and softening the cataract for less complicated removal.

Moreover, the introduction of intraocular lenses (IOLs) that deal with astigmatism and presbyopia throughout cataract surgical procedure has further improved individual end results. These advanced lenses can resolve refractive mistakes, lowering the requirement for glasses or get in touch with lenses post-surgery. Surgeons now have the capability to tailor the option of IOL per person's unique visual needs, guaranteeing an extra personalized and rewarding outcome.
